A graduated cylinder or a volumetric flask is commonly used for measuring liquids in science. These instruments are designed to accurately measure the volume of a liquid.
The liquid displacement formula is used to calculate the volume of an irregularly shaped object by measuring the volume of liquid it displaces when submerged in a container of liquid. The formula states that the volume of the object is equal to the difference in volume between the liquid level before and after submerging the object.
When measuring the density of an object, you are determining how much mass is contained in a given volume. This is typically calculated using the formula density = mass/volume. The resulting value helps to understand the object's material composition and behavior in different environments, such as buoyancy in fluids. Density measurements are crucial in various fields, including physics, engineering, and material science.

The volume of a cube is calculated using the formula ( V = s^3 ), where ( s ) is the length of a side. For a cube with sides measuring 5 cm, the volume is ( 5^3 = 125 ) cubic centimeters. Therefore, the volume of the cube is 125 cm³.
